Start With a Strong Technical SEO Foundation

Before focusing on content or link building, every United States business should ensure its website is technically sound. This means achieving fast page load speeds, implementing a mobile-responsive design, using HTTPS security, and resolving crawl errors that prevent search engines from indexing your pages. Tools such as Google Search Console and Screaming Frog can help identify technical issues that may be holding your site back. A technically healthy website provides the solid groundwork that all other SEO efforts depend upon, and neglecting this step can undermine even the most well-crafted content strategy.

Create High-Quality, Intent-Driven Content

Content remains one of the most influential ranking factors for Google in 2026. Rather than producing generic articles, focus on creating content that directly addresses the questions and problems your target audience is actively searching for. Conduct keyword research using tools like Ahrefs or SEMrush to identify high-intent search queries relevant to your industry and location. Structure your content with clear headings, concise paragraphs, and actionable takeaways. Long-form content that thoroughly covers a topic tends to earn more backlinks and social shares, which amplifies its SEO impact over time. Consistency in publishing is equally important for building topical authority in your niche.

Build Authority Through Strategic Link Acquisition

Earning backlinks from reputable United States-based websites signals to Google that your content is trustworthy and valuable. Focus on quality over quantity by pursuing links from industry publications, local news outlets, government websites, and respected blogs within your sector. Guest posting, digital PR campaigns, and creating shareable resources such as original research or infographics are effective methods for attracting natural backlinks. Avoid black-hat tactics like buying links or participating in link schemes, as these violate Google's guidelines and can result in manual penalties. A steady, ethical link-building approach will compound your SEO results significantly over the long term.
